Helping your child with SEND to look after their teeth and gums

Healthwatch Oxfordshire wants to hear from parents and carers of children with special educational needs or a disability (SEND) in Oxfordshire about what it is like supporting their child to look after their teeth and gums. The county’s independent health and care watchdog would like to know what is helpful, what is challenging and what would support parents and carers. They would like to hear from them even if their child has not had a formal SEND diagnosis. They are asking about all aspects of oral health, including information, learning and support to prevent problems with teeth and gums, as well as treatment by dentists and specialists like orthodontists.
